Frequently asked questions
What is docwhispr?
Turn PDF, PowerPoint, and image figures into annotated whiteboard videos and editable slides. Share them for comments and figure-grounded AI Q&A.
What documents work best?
Manuals, datasheets, and training material with embedded figures work best, especially when the diagrams carry the meaning.
Can I edit slides after generation?
Yes. Edit slides in Excalidraw, adjust highlights, and regenerate the video without rerunning the full pipeline.
How does docwhispr compare with screen recording?
docwhispr extracts figures and creates a concise narrated lesson, so you do not need to record a live camera or scroll through the document yourself.
